"American strat at Mexican prices"

Overall: 5 out of 5 stars
(see rating details)
This review has been selected by our experts as particularly helpful.
I do not plan on replacing this product ever. It was built to last a lifetime and that's just how long I'm going to use it. The only other guitars that I would like to buy in the future are an acoustic, as no electric can imitate it, and a guitar with double humbucking pick-ups, but it will definitely be another strat.
Sound
The sound is amazing, rock, classic rock, punk, and blues all sound great. I've even played it with a folk group and the clean tone kept up with the acoustics. However, the pickups are not quite powerful enough for zeppelin, metallica, that type of stuff. I tried a higher level american stratbefore buying this one, but the highway 1 was far better.
Features
I got two whammy bars with the guitar. It came with a gig bag, but I upgraded to a hard case. The hard case is WELL WORTH IT. Upgrading to lacking strap is another must.
Ease of Use
The guitar has great string action. The maple neck improves the string action a lot, but sacrifices a little sustain. The knobs and pick-up selector caneasily be manipulated by the pinky, very useful when performing, specially when playing lead. The tuners are sensitive, but they don't drift much and don't buzz at all.
Quality
The product is really well made. I've never had a problem with any of it. The only problem is that the satin finish scratches easy. But this quality is worth the tone it creates.
Value
This an amazing value. The tone surpassed any higher-priced fender I've ever played
Manufacturer Support
I've never had any trouble, so I can't really say anything about support
The Wow Factor
Everything important about this guitar is unsurpassable. The tone is amazing; the comfort and ease of playing is amazing; the strat body design and headstock looks cooler than the tele, the sg, the les paul, or the flying v. The transparent finish shows off the wood's grain.

"BIG TONE FOR LITTLE $$$"

Overall: 4.5 out of 5 stars
(see rating details)
Verified Customer zZounds has verified that this reviewer made a purchase from us.
I plan to keep this guitar for a long time. As of now I have this, a Les Paul and a custom made Washburn & I have no intentions of searching for any other guitars. To me, these fill my every need when it comes to my tone.
Sound
I'm into the vintage & blues sound and I gotta say this strat nails it down! Nice vibe and feels like an ax thats been around for awhile. The tone is 100% vintage strat-there's no mistaking it. I've had it for about a year now & it is now my main guitar. Truely a joy to play. This baby will be with me for many years to come.
Features
It's a strat. 3 singles, 1 volume 2 tone & 5-way switch.
Quality
ok to be fair I have to knock a few points here. It seems well built(neck is straight, joint is tight, etc.etc..) but the finish is paper thin & is scratched easily. So, take care not to thrash it around too much. Also, seems a little plain-jane what with the plain white pickguard & such. I know thats what keeps the cost down, just my opinion.
Value
For a USA made Fender the price simply cannot be beat.
